Pecan - transforming the lives of unemployed people

Pecan is a charity that helps transform the lives of disadvantaged people through various training and motivational projects. Much of its focus is in helping unemployed people get and hold satisfying jobs. Based in Peckham, Elephant and Castle, Camberwell, Orpington, Burwell (near Cambridge) and Hackney, it trains over 1,500 unemployed people in London every year.
